Today the Utility Regulator publishes a proposed next steps paper on introducing Contestability in Electricity Connections within Northern Ireland.

The purpose of the paper is to seek views and comments on issues associated with the implementation of contestability in connections to the transmission and distribution networks.  In particular, views are sought on activities that are likely to be contestable, accreditation arrangements and the application of operation and maintenance costs. This document is most likely to be of interest to all parties owning, connecting to, or providing connections to the electricity network in Northern Ireland.

We would also welcome contributions from customers, customer representative bodies, financial institutions and other interested parties.
